Well it seems all is well, and subject to a meeting with my accountant on Monday next, in Leeds, and as long as he doesn't rise any glaring concerns then the Black Pig will be a reality. I have told the present owner the same thing and if all goes well Monday morning, we will shake hands on the deal on Monday afternoon.
So when will I open the doors, well the plan would be to take the keys over on Monday August 8th and the commence with the changes that need to happen - decorating, cleaning, ripping out the old broken stuff and commencing with the re-configuration works, which will take a few days. The sign writers are now engaged with and they can complete the Black Pig logos and signage in a day. This will mean that, if all goes to plan the doors will open for trading on the following Monday, August 15th, but as I have negotiated 2 months free rent, I can afford to slip slightly, however, I would prefer this not to happen.
The plan would be to open on the Sunday 14th August for a dry run, so if you are about, please come along and experience what we will have to offer.....
All I can do now is continue to look at the finer detail and make sure that I've missed nothing, although I am sure that I will, but this dream is about to become reality, living by one's own decisions, learning from my mistakes and I'm sure there will be few.
I have also started to engage with my potential suppliers, Rowcliffe being the main cheese supplier, and have organised to meet with the rep early next week to ensure I have the right product, in the right place and at the right price. Others do need to be engaged with, however, as Devizes is a small town the gossip needs to be kept to a minimum, as there are already some rumours going round.
So Monday is the day....lets hope my accountant doesn't find any glaring issues.
